Description


The teacher training program “Bachelor of Education in Protestant Religious Education (Teaching at Grammar Schools and Comprehensive Schools)“ is a 6-semester program conducted in German. Throughout their education, students will gain a fundamental understanding of Educational Sciences, Subject Didactics and Methodology, and German for immigrant students. They can combine their main subject with two other i.e. English, Chemistry, Nutrition, Musicology, Sports, and more. Through various case studies and application-oriented seminars, participants will acquire hands-on experiance and key competencies needed for day-to-day operations. Additionally, the program promotes the development of soft skills such as teamwork, moderation, problem-solving, communication and organisation, etc. The BEd prepares graduates to assume teaching positions at high schools or comprehensive schools. They can also pursue a subsequent Master’s degree.
